Description:
Au88Ge12 as a kind of gold-based eutectic solder has a melting temperature of 361 ºC . Au88Ge12 has the advantages of low vapor pressure, low contact resistance, good adhesion to substrate, high electrical and thermal conductivity, etc. It is
considered as an ideal sputtering and evaporation source, and is widely used in GaAs MESFET to form ohmic contacts. As a kind of eutectic solder, Au88Ge12 is also used in the field of die bonding in the packaging of transistors, integrated circuits and other components.
Solder Composition:
Element | Wt% |
Gold (Au) | Margin |
Germanium (Ge) | 12.0 ± 0.5 |
Physical Properties:
Product name | Melting point/ºC solid / liquid phase | Density g/cm3 | Resistivity µΩ·m | Thermal conductivity W/m·K | Thermal expansion coefficient 10-6/ºC | Tensile strength Mpa |
Au88Ge12 | 361 | 14.67 | 0.151 | 44 | 13.4 | 185 |

Operation Details:
- Picking up:
Use an anti-static tools to pick up the solder to prevent solder contamination and deformation.
- Operating environment:
Atmosphere | Parameter requirements |
N2 | Oxygen concentration(200~ 1000ppm) |
Vacuum | Vacuum degree ≤ 2.0×10-3Pa |
- Flux Compatibility:
Au88Ge12 solder is compatible with regular no-clean and water-soluble electronic grade fluxes currently.

Category | Products | Solidus(ºC) | Liquidus(ºC) | Density (g/cm3) | Resistivity (μΩ·m) | Thermal Conductivity (W/m ·K) | CTE (10-6/ºC) | Tensile Strength (MPa) |
Solder Metal | In51Bi32.5Sn16.5 | / | 60(e) | 7.88 | 0.522 | / | 22 | 33.44 |
In66.3Bi33.7 | / | 72(e) | 7.99 | / | / | / | / | |
Bi50Pb28Sn22 | / | 100(e) | 9.44 | / | / | / | / | |
In52Sn48 | / | 118(e) | 7.3 | 0. 147 | 34 | 20 | 12 | |
In50Sn50 | 118 | 125 | 7.3 | 0. 147 | 34 | 20 | 11.86 | |
Bi58Sn42 | / | 138(e) | 8.56 | 0.383 | 19 | 15 | 55. 16 | |
Bi57Sn42Ag1 | 138 | 140 | 8.57 | / | / | / | / | |
In97Ag3 | / | 143(e) | 7.38 | 0.075 | 73 | 22 | 5.5 | |
Sn43Pb43Bi14 | 144 | 163 | 9.02 | / | / | 24 | 44. 1 | |
In80Pb15Ag5 | 149 | 154 | 7.85 | 0. 133 | 43 | 28 | 17.58 | |
Sn53Pb37Bi10 | 150 | 168 | 8.65 | / | / | / | / | |
Sn70Pb18In12 | 154 | 167 | 7.79 | 0. 141 | 45 | 24 | 36.68 | |
In100 | / | 157(mp) | 7.31 | 0.072 | 86 | 29 | 1.88 | |
In70Pb30 | 165 | 175 | 8. 19 | 0. 195 | 38 | 28 | 23.79 | |
In60Pb40 | 174 | 185 | 8.52 | 0.246 | 29 | 27 | 28.61 | |
Sn77.2In20Ag2.8 | 175 | 187 | 7.25 | 0. 176 | 54 | 28 | 46.88 | |
Sn62Pb36Ag2 | / | 179(e) | 8.42 | 0. 145 | 42 | 27 | 44 | |
Sn63Pb37 | / | 183(e) | 8.4 | 0. 146 | 51 | 25 | 52 | |
In50Pb50 | 184 | 210 | 8.86 | 0.287 | 22 | 27 | 32.2 | |
Pb60In40 | 197 | 231 | 9.3 | 0.331 | 19 | 26 | 34.48 | |
Sn86.9In10Ag3. 1 | 201 | 205 | 7.37 | / | / | / | / | |
Au10Sn90 | / | 217(e) | 7.78 | / | / | / | 50.2 | |
SAC387(Sn95.5Ag3.8Cu0.7) | / | 217(ne) | 7.4 | 0. 132 | 57 | 22 | 48 | |
SAC305(Sn96.5Ag3.0Cu0.5) | 217 | 218 | 7.37 | 0. 132 | 58 | 21 | 50 | |
Sn96.5Ag3.5 | / | 221(e) | 7.37 | 0. 108 | 33 | 30 | 39 | |
Sn99.3Cu0.7 | / | 227(e) | 7.31 | / | / | / | / | |
Sn100 | / | 232(mp) | 7.29 | 0. 111 | 73 | 24 | 13. 1 | |
Sn65Ag25Sb10 | / | 233(e) | 7.8 | / | / | 36 | 117.2 | |
Sn95Sb5 | 235 | 240 | 7.25 | 0. 145 | 28 | 31 | 40.7 | |
Sn90Sb10 | 240 | 250 | 7.22 | / | 42 | 27 | 44 | |
Pb75In25 | 240 | 260 | 9.97 | 0.375 | 18 | 26 | 37.58 | |
Pb88Sn10Ag2 | 268 | 290 | 10.75 | 0.203 | 27 | 29 | 22.48 | |
Pb90Sn10 | 275 | 302 | 10.75 | / | / | 24.6 | 32 | |
Au80Sn20 | / | 280(e) | 14.52 | 0.224 | 57 | 16 | 276 | |
Pb92.5Sn5Ag2.5 | 287 | 296 | 11.02 | 0.2 | 29 | 24 | 29.03 | |
Pb90Sn5Ag3In2 | 294 | 297 | 10.89 | / | / | / | / | |
Pb92.5In5Ag2.5 | 300 | 310 | 11.02 | 0.313 | 25 | 25 | 31.44 | |
Au88Ge12 | / | 361(e) | 14.67 | 0. 151 | 44 | 13.4 | 185 | |
Au96.8Si3.2 | / | 363(e) | 15.4 | / | 27 | 12 | 255 | |
Au98Si2 | 363 | 390 | 16.92 | / | / | / | / | |
Brazing Metal | Ag60Cu30Sn10 | 600 | 720 | 9.58 | / | / | / | / |
Ag72Cu28 | / | 780(e) | 10 | / | 352 | 17.8 | 250-360 | |
Ag50Cu50 | 780 | 870 | 9.67 | / | / | / | / | |
Au60Ag20Cu20 | 835 | 845 | 13.79 | / | / | / | / | |
Ag92.5Cu7.5 | / | / | 10.37 | / | / | / | / | |
Au80Cu20 | / | 910(e) | 15.67 | / | / | / | / | |
Au50Cu50 | 955 | 970 | 12.22 | / | / | / | / | |
Ag100 | / | 961(mp) | 10.49 | 0.0163 | 429 | / | 180 | |
Au100 | / | 1064(mp) | 19.3 | 0.0221 | 318 | 14 | 138 | |
Cu100 | / | 1083(mp) | 8.96 | 0.0172 | 401 | / | 246 |
